About The Coffee Bean & Tea Leaf Philippines
The Coffee Bean & Tea Leaf was founded in Los Angeles in 1963 and is credited with inventing the blended iced coffee drink in 1987 years before other major chains introduced their own versions of the format. In the Philippines, the brand is operated under Rustan Marketing Corporation, part of the long-established Rustan Group, and has grown into a fixture in malls and business districts across Metro Manila and beyond.
Locally, CBTL has positioned itself as a slightly more premium alternative in the Philippine café space, competing directly with other major international coffee chains while carving out its own identity around its Ice Blended drinks and tea program. The brand also runs “Hope in a Box,” a bottled water initiative where all proceeds go toward funding public school classrooms in the Philippines, tying the brand to a specific local social cause.
